So, today I was leaving my house to go hang out with some friends and I was pulled over like 2 blocks away from my house. I was originally pulled over for tint, but then my dumbass remembered my license was expired.

Long story short I got a misdemenor for driving without a license. They said having an expired license is the same as having no license. The cop was cool in a way in that he didn't impound my car because I was so close to my house. My dad came and picked up my car. The ticket is 12500(a)cvc.

Does anybody have any advice for this kind of ticket? I read somewhere that if I show up to court with a valid license, the case might be dismissed? I kind of doubt that though because the ticket says non correctable.

Yeah, as said, the "non-correctable" part just means that the cop is making sure you have to go to court for it, instead of getting it renewed and having it signed off by a Sheriff/CHP.

Renew your shit, go to court with the expectation of getting it thrown out, and enjoy the rest of your day.

Technically, your license has to be valid when your citation was issued to have the citation just "thrown" out with a $10 fee. Since yours was expired, the judge can enforce maximum penalties on you if he wanted. You now have the burden of proving to the court that you truly "forgot" to renew your license, and that you did not have bad intentions.

Get your license renewed ASAP, go to the courthouse right after, and meet with the judge. Make sure you look presentable, and hopefully the judge will reduce your fine. Regardless of what happens, you have to accept the consequences because you were driving illegally, and you're lucky that they didnt cite you for anything worse. Do NOT lag on getting this corrected!! The faster you do all this stuff, the more the judge will believe you are on top of everything.

Well you guys were right. I finally showed up to court with my renewed license and proof of insurance, and the judge dismissed both counts. Sucks that the dismissal fee is now $25 instead of the $10 that is used to be.
